Ormonde Jayne adds to Four Corners collection with Latin America-inspired scent

By Becky Bargh | Published: 19-Jan-2021

The new Montabaco Verano fragrance blends tobacco leaf with a floral composition

British fragrance brand Ormonde Jayne has kicked off 2021 with a new perfume launch as part of its Four Corners range.

The collection comprises products that pay homage to destinations around the world.

Becoming the fourth fragrance in the line, the new Montabaco Verano scent (£145) takes inspiration from Latin America and is formulated with tobacco leaf and a floral composition of magnolia, jasmine and rose.

For a burst of citrus, the brand has included grapefruit, orange and juniper in the scent’s top notes, while its dry down tones star suede, moss, tonka and sandalwood.

Also available in the range are Tsarina, Nawab of Oudh and QI.

In keeping with the brand’s fragrance design, the scent is housed deep blue a rectangular bottle with gold cap.

The product is also available in Ormonde Jayne’s Hair Mist, Reed Diffuser and candle collections.
